The Eukaryotic cells have five several DNA polymerases; α, β, γ, δ or ε. The DNA polymerases contained in replication of chromosomal DNA are α and δ. DNA polymerases β or ε are contained in DNA repair. Overall of these polymerases except DNA polymerase γ are situated in the nucleus; DNA polymerase γ is found replicates mitochondrial DNA and in mitochondria.
